Remaining Sunan and Etiquettes of Using the Right Hand
1. In Islam, the right side is considered blessed because on the Day of Judgement, the scroll of deeds of the righteous will also be in this hand.[1]
2. Sayyidatunā ꜤĀ’isha Siddīqa رَضِىَ اللّٰهُ عَـنْهُ states: The Messenger of Allah صَلَّى الـلّٰـهُ عَلَيْهِ وَاٰلِهٖ وَسَلَّم preferred to begin all his affairs from the right side.[2]
3. Eat with your right hand. Eating, drinking, taking, and giving with the left hand is the method of Satan.[3]
4. When offering water to someone, the jug is usually in the right hand while the glass is in the left, and glasses are given to others with the left hand. If one needs to take both a jug and a glass, then we tend to take them with both hands at once, which is incorrect. First, take the jug with your right hand, then hold the jug in your left hand so that your right hand becomes free, and now take the glass with your right hand.
